Categorization of nuclear material
    
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
|     Nuclear    |         Form         | Category |   Category    |    Category    |
|    Material    |                      |     I    |       II      |    III <c>     |
|----------------|----------------------|----------|---------------|----------------|
| 1. Plutonium   | Unirradiated <b>     | 2 kg or  | Less than     | 500 g or less  |
| <a>            |                      | more     | 2 kg but more | but more than  |
|                |                      |          | than 500 g    | 15 g           |
|----------------|----------------------|----------|---------------|----------------|
| 2. Uranium-235 | Unirradiated <b>     |          |               |                |
|                | - uranium enriched   | - 5 kg   | - Less than   | - 1 kg or less |
|                | to 20% 235  or more  | or more  | 5 kg but more | but more than  |
|                |           U          |          | than 1 kg     | 15 g           |
|                | - uranium enriched   |          | - 10 kg or    | - Less than    |
|                | to 10% 235  but less |          | more          | 10 kg but more |
|                |           U          |          |               | than 1 kg      |
|                | than 20% 235         |          |               |                |
|                |             U        |          |               |                |
|                | - uranium enriched   |          |               | - 10 kg or     |
|                | above natural, but   |          |               | more           |
|                | less than 10% 235    |          |               |                |
|                |                  U   |          |               |                |
|----------------|----------------------|----------|---------------|----------------|
| 3. Uranium-233 | Unirradiated <b>     | 2 kg or  | Less than     | 500 g or less  |
|                |                      | more     | 2 kg but more | but more than  |
|                |                      |          | than 500 g    | 15 g           |
|----------------|----------------------|----------|---------------|----------------|
| 4. Irradiated  |                      |          | Depleted or   |                |
| Fuel           |                      |          | natural       |                |
|                |                      |          | uranium,      |                |
|                |                      |          | thorium or    |                |
|                |                      |          | low-enriched  |                |
|                |                      |          | fuel (less    |                |
|                |                      |          | than 10%      |                |
|                |                      |          | fissile       |                |
|                |                      |          | content)      |                |
|                |                      |          | <d>/<e>       |                |
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
    
     --------------------------------
     <a>   All  plutonium  except  that  with  isotopic  concentration
exceeding 80% in plutonium-238.
     <b>  Nuclear  material  not  irradiated  in  a reactor or nuclear
material  irradiated  in a reactor but with a radiation level equal to
or less than 1 Gy/hr (100 rads/hr) at one meter unshielded.
     <c>  Quantities  not falling in Category III and natural uranium,
depleted   uranium  and  thorium  should  be  protected  at  least  in
accordance with prudent management practice.
     <d> Although this level of protection is recommended, it would be
open to the Parties, upon evaluation of the specific circumstances, to
assign a different category of physical protection.
     <e>  Other  fuel which by virtue of its original fissile material
content  is  classified  as Category I or II before irradiation may be
reduced  one  category  level  while the radiation level from the fuel
exceeds 1 Gy/hr (100 rads/hr) at one meter unshielded.
